The Ohio State University College of Dentistry seeks a Clinical Instructor House Staff (CIHS) in the Dental Anesthesiology Training Program.

This Clinical Instructor House Staff position is a full-time position intended to provide an expanded knowledge base in dental anesthesiology and provide clinical care experience as part of the dental school graduate program. Dental Anesthesiology provides excellent, comprehensive treatment and offers anesthesia care at the postdoctoral level including hospital-based anesthesia, as well as treatment of medically compromised and special needs patients. The Dental Anesthesiology program has 4 to 6 resident doctors who serve a 3-year appointment. Residents appointed to the Clinical Instructor House Staff position in the Dental Anesthesiology resident training program provide care to patients under the supervision of an attending faculty member in accordance to the guidelines of the department, The Ohio State University Medical Center (OSUMC) GME office, and CODA.

Required: D.D.S. or D.M.D.; graduation from an accredited dental school and eligible for post-graduate approved training; required to be eligible to obtain a training certificate, required to be American Heart Association certified in ACLS training. The Ohio State University College of Dentistry is the fourth largest public dental school in the United States and it is the only public dental school in Ohio. The college is divided into ten divisions with all major ADA-recognized dental specialties represented. The College has approximately 600 students in its undergraduate, professional, and graduate programs.

Physical Requirements
A CIHS needs to be able to: use of both hands, dexterity in the fingers and the ability to manipulate instruments, materials, dental hand pieces, and operate dental equipment. The use of feet is necessary to manipulate the rheostat for hand pieces or other dental equipment. The body must be able to work from a dental stool in order to perform most dental procedures. The ability to sit and stand for a duration of time is also necessary. Other specific requirements include color spectrum differentiation; manual dexterity/motor coordination, hand-eye coordination, physical communications; visual acuity and communication/language development. Individuals in this position may be exposed to bloodborne pathogens, chemical hazards (skin irritants), vibrating equipment, use of sharp instruments and latex.
